全载体车身结构件级进冲压成形排样设计

摘    要:为复杂构形的车身结构件级进冲压成形排样设计提供参考,以全载体形式车身结构件为例,首先提出排样存在的主要设计问题,明确了设计任务;然后分析了制件的级进冲压成形工艺,设计了制件的排样图;最后通过实冲试验验证了排样工艺的合理性。试验所获产品零件无开裂、起皱等成形性问题,且关键成形部位达到了零件图的形位精度设计要求。

关 键 词:车身结构件  排样图  实冲试验  全载体形式

Layout Design of Progressive Stamping Forming for Full Carrier Body Structural Parts

Abstract:In order to provide a reference for layout design of progressive stamping forming of complex body structural parts, the main problems existing in layout designingare put forward and the design tasks are defined with the example of the full carrier body structure. Then the progressive stamping process of the partsis analyzed and the layout of the partsis designed. Finally, the rationality of the layout process is verified by the actual punching test. There are no forming problems such as cracking and wrinkling, and the key forming parts meet the shape and position precision design requirements of the part drawing. The results show that the layout design for full carrier is reasonable, and its process has practical reference value.
Keywords:car body structural parts  layout  real punching test  full carrier
